runtime: copy print/println support from Go 1.7
Update the compiler to use the new names. Add calls to printlock and printunlock around print statements. Move expression evaluation before the call to printlock. Update g's writebuf field to a slice, and adjust C code accordingly. Reviewed-on: https://go-review.googlesource.com/30717 From-SVN: r240956
